Download Solution PDFWhich of the following are correct?
(a) Quartile deviation is a measure of variability taken about median.
(b) Coefficient of variation is the percentage variation of the group adjusted with median.
(c) In positive skewness, test is too easy for the subjects.
(d) Degree of freedom can be defined as the number of independent vaiables which constitutes a statistic.
Choose the correct option from the given codes:

Download Solution PDFStatistical measures are used in data analysis to describe and summarize data, identify patterns and relationships, and make inferences about populations based on sample data. These measures include measures of central tendency, measures of variability, and measures of association or correlation.
Key Points The given options pertain to statistical measures and concepts commonly used in data analysis.
- Quartile deviation is a measure of variability taken about the median.
- It is calculated as half the difference between the upper and lower quartiles, and provides a measure of spread around the median.
- Degrees of freedom refer to the number of independent observations or variables in a statistical analysis that are available to vary.
- It is an important concept in hypothesis testing, as it determines the critical values for a given level of significance, and affects the precision of estimates of population parameters.
Confusion Points
- Option (b) is incorrect. Coefficient of variation is the ratio of the standard deviation to the mean, expressed as a percentage.
- It is used to compare the variability of two or more data sets that have different means or units of measurement.
- Option (c) is also incorrect. Positive skewness indicates that the distribution is skewed to the right, with a longer tail on the right side of the curve.
- This would imply that the test is more difficult for subjects who score high, rather than easy.
